Different Types of Double Glazed Windows

Double-glazed windows are an excellent option for homes. They can be constructed from single or triple-paned glass and can be fitted with an insulating film Low-E (low energy) to help keep out the cold. These windows can be found in a number of different types, including sliding and fixed doors.

Sliding windows

Sliding windows are a popular option for homeowners looking to improve their homes. These windows can offer modern and sleek appearance as well as enhancing airflow within your home.

Compared to other types of windows, sliding windows can offer a clear view. They are also easy to operate. They aren't appropriate for every situation. They are also less efficient in terms of energy.

Sliding windows are perfect for rooms that are used throughout the day. This includes the living and kitchen areas. Since you'll have an amazing view from them it is not necessary to worry about artificial lighting. A new set of windows could also improve the curb appeal of your house.

Unlike double-hung windows, sliding windows require little maintenance. You can clean the mechanism of your slider by vacuuming it or spraying oil-based lubricant on the tracks. You may also need to replace the rollers after several years.

Fixed windows

A fixed double-glazed window can be an excellent way to let in light and maintain a view. They can also be problematic with time. This could be due to condensation or the retention of water within the frame. There are several ways to fix this issue.

The first step is to drill two small holes in the bottom of the window. After drilling, you can put a desiccate packet into each hole. These packets will trap dirt and moisture between the panes. You can also install trickle vents in the windows to allow for increased air circulation.

Another method to increase the efficiency of your double glazed windows is to install a ventilation system. This will increase air circulation and reduce heat loss.

If you're experiencing problems with a set of double-glazed windows, the best method to repair them is to contact the company you purchased windows from. Manufacturers provide warranties of up to 10 or even 20 years. If there is no warranty, you are able to buy replacement panes.

Another alternative is to replace the entire window. This is the most cost-effective option, but it is not always the cheapest option. It can also improve the appearance of your home. It is also possible to reseal your windows.

Although this may be the most efficient solution to your problem however, it's unlikely to offer the same benefits over the long term. If your windows have been leaking for some time it could be the only solution.

Examine for water droplets and condensation around double-glazed windows to determine if they are leaking. This is a sign that the air pocket in your interior has been damaged.

Casement windows

Casement windows are a fantastic option for your home if your objective is to improve ventilation or open your windows easily. These types of windows offer numerous advantages, such as top-to-bottom ventilation and a view that is free of obstruction, and great weatherproofing.

In the US Casement windows typically come with a hand-crank However, other options are also available. Push-open windows are available from certain companies that do not have hinges.

The contemporary design of casement windows is usually made of an aluminum frame, however there are also contemporary timber frames that are available. These frames provide a clean, modern look. They also have specialist glazing options that can increase the efficiency of thermal energy and soundproofing.

Certain casement windows have screen. This stops insects from entering. It also lets you choose from a range of grille patterns, which can add classic appeal.

One of the most significant advantages of casement windows is their versatility. They can be grouped together to create stunning combinations. These windows can help make your home stand out even if it's a simple.

Casement windows are easy to maintain and offer large, uninterrupted views. They're also perfect for use in bathrooms and kitchens. Most often, these windows are placed above cabinets or countertops.

Casement windows are also extremely efficient in terms of energy efficiency. Casement windows are usually more airtight that double-hung windows. That means you can save money on heating and cooling bills.

Casement windows can also be found in a variety of styles, shapes, and sizes. Triple-pane glass

If you're thinking of upgrading your windows to keep the warm air inside and the cold air out, you might be interested in triple-pane glass. This kind of window can help you save energy and increase the value of your home. But, it can also add thousands of dollars to the price of the windows you purchase.

Triple-pane windows are a great option if you live somewhere with long, hot summers and cold winters. While these kinds of windows are more expensive, they are able to pay for themselves in less than a decade. In fact, they could cut your power consumption by as much as 30%..

These windows let the sun shine through while keeping cold drafts from your home. They can also block out noise. Certain models can also incorporate an insulating gas which can improve insulation.

Triple-paned windows that have the highest insulation will have a spacer. They'll also have low-e glasses which is a tiny coating that helps the glass perform better.

Triple-pane glass has the benefit of preventing condensation from occurring. You've probably seen this type of condensation on the outside of triple-glazed windows. It's not a problem because it's not unusual for windows to become smoky during winter.

Triple-pane windows offer more insulation, less noise, and the ability to keep the heat inside. They are not for all, however. Insulating film with low emissivity (low-E)

Double glazing with low-E (low energy) insulation films can help you save money while also improving your home's comfort. These films also help to block the amount of UV radiation that enters your home. By blocking ultraviolet rays, you can avoid the damage to your furniture and upvc door repair near me keep your resale value high.

Low-E window film is easy to apply and can be removed with ease. Before purchasing, make sure you check your climate and the position of your windows. You might need to hire an expert to install this type of window film.

Low E glass has the principal benefit of reflecting solar heat. In summer, low-E window film can assist in conserving up to 50 percent of the inside's heat. This coating can help keep your home warm during winter, and also reduce the cost of heating.

There are two types of Low E films. The first is a tough coating, which is made by pouring melted Tin on the glass's surface. Another is a soft coat that is made by depositing a thin layer of metals in a vacuum chamber. Soft coats are more insulation-friendly than hard coats and have higher R values.
